At time t - 0. a diver jumps from a platform above the water. At time t seconds. the diver is s(t) =-16t2 + 16t + 32 feet above the water. When asked for units, use ft for feet and sec for seconds How many feet above the water is the platform? Just enter the number without units. After how many seconds does she hit the water? Just enter the number without units. A What is the divers velocity when she hits the water? Enter the number in the first blank and the units in the second. A What is her acceleration when she hits the water? Just enter the number without units. A
